Recharge APIs are the backbone of digital recharge platforms. They enable businesses to offer mobile recharge, DTH recharge, and bill payment services seamlessly through their applications or websites.
With the rapid growth of fintech services in India, recharge APIs have become essential for startups, retailers, and digital service providers.
What is a Recharge API?
A Recharge API (Application Programming Interface) is a service that allows software applications to connect with telecom operators and service providers to perform recharges automatically.
It acts as a bridge between your platform and service providers, enabling real-time transactions.
How Recharge API Works
1: User Enters Details
- Mobile number or customer ID
- Operator selection
- Recharge amount
2: API Request Sent
The system sends a request to the recharge API provider.
3: Operator Processes Request
The telecom operator verifies and processes the recharge.
4: Response Returned
- Success or failure message
- Transaction ID generated
Types of Recharge APIs
Mobile Recharge API
- Supports prepaid and postpaid recharges
DTH Recharge API
- Enables TV recharge services
Data Card Recharge API
- Internet and dongle recharge
Utility Bill API
- Electricity, gas, water bill payments
/services-available-in-a-bbps-portal
Key Features of Recharge API
- Real-time recharge processing
- Multi-operator support
- Secure transactions
- High uptime
- Easy integration
- Detailed reporting
Benefits of Using Recharge API
- Automates recharge process
- Reduces manual work
- Increases transaction speed
- Enables business scalability
- Provides recurring income
Recharge API Integration Process
1: Choose API Provider
Select a reliable provider with:
- High success rate
- Fast response time
/how-to-choose-best-bbps-api-provider
2: Get API Credentials
- API key
- Secret key
- Access tokens
3: Integrate API
- Connect backend system
- Configure endpoints
- Handle requests and responses
4: Testing
- Test recharge flow
- Verify responses
5: Go Live
- Start processing real transactions
Cost of Recharge API
- Basic API: ₹5,000 – ₹15,000
- Setup cost: ₹10,000 – ₹30,000
- Advanced APIs: ₹50,000+
/recharge-software-development-cost
Security in Recharge APIs
Recharge APIs ensure:
- Encrypted communication
- Secure authentication
- Fraud prevention systems
https://www.npci.org.in/
https://uidai.gov.in/
Challenges in Recharge API Usage
- API downtime
- Transaction failures
- Low margins
- Integration complexity
Who Should Use Recharge APIs?
- Fintech startups
- Recharge portal owners
- Retailers and distributors
- Software developers
Conclusion
Recharge APIs are essential for building modern digital recharge platforms. They provide automation, speed, and scalability, making them a powerful tool for businesses in the fintech ecosystem.
By choosing the right API provider and implementing proper integration, businesses can create a reliable and profitable recharge system.



